The Kern County Public Works Department is soliciting bids for Contract 26028 to replace the gatehouse scale at the Shafter Recycling and Sanitary Landfill located at 17621 Scofield Rd, Shafter, CA. The project requires the contractor to provide all labor, materials, and equipment to remove the existing mechanical cement pit truck scale and install a new Avery Weigh-Tronix Bridgemont-HD analog scale measuring 70 feet in length, 10 feet in width, and 14 inches in height, featuring three decks and two manholes. Additional work includes pouring new footings or piers, repairing asphalt and concrete edging, integrating the existing indicator, and performing all necessary testing and calibration. The project must be completed within 90 working days from the commencement of contract time. Bids are due by September 10, 2026, at 11:00 AM and must be submitted in a sealed envelope. The contract will be awarded to the apparent low responsive and responsible bidder based on qualifications, financial ability, and compliance with requirements. Bidders must provide a 10 percent bid bond and adhere to California Labor Code prevailing wage and apprentice requirements. Required documentation includes a bid form, vendor information, non-collusion declarations, and bidder certifications. Once awarded, the contractor must provide construction performance and labor and material payment bonds. Invoices are to be submitted to the Public Works Department Accounting Division in Bakersfield, with payment issued within 30 days of approval.
